All You Need to Know about Aortic aneurysm

Diagnostics of aortic aneurysm

Physicians utilize the following methods of diagnostics to determine the stage of the disease:

  • CT scan;
  • ultrasound;
  • MRI;
  • chest X-ray.

The abdominal aortic aneurysm screening cost depends on diagnostic method, physician qualification, and hospital accreditation. During the diagnostics physicians locate the aneurysm and determine if the operation is needed.

Aortic aneurysm treatment options

Non-surgical

Non-surgical management of aortic aneurysm comes down to maintaining low blood pressure of a patient. Drugs can’t cure the condition, but prevent aneurysm from further advancing. Doctors advise patients to quit bad habits, such as smoking. Every 6-12 months physicians carry out a diagnostic to control patient’s condition.

Surgical

Aortic repair using graft tube

Physicians evaluate all risks considering surgery as one of the abdominal aortic aneurysm treatment options. The key factor is the probability of vessel rupture. The surgery is performed as soon as тon-surgical management ceases to be effective and the risk of rupture is above 20%. There are 2 types of procedures:

  1. Open surgery. During the intervention physicians expose dilated part of the vessel by making incisions in the abdomen and/or the neck. Doctors replace diseased section of the aorta with a special synthetic graft tube. Healthy ends of the vessel are sewn to the graft by hand. Aneurysmal tissue is closed around the synthetic tube.
  2. Endovascular surgery. This procedure presumes placing of the stent in aneurysm location. The operation is minimally-invasive, it puts patient’s body under less stress and requires shorter hospital stay. However, additional operations may be required later if a patient doesn’t change their lifestyle. Long-term survival rate for both operations is the same.

Rehabilitation

Endovascular surgery is the same-day operation, meaning that a patient is dismissed from a clinic on the day of the procedure in most cases. After open surgery patient is placed in the Intensive Care Unit (ICU) for 1-4 days. In-hospital stay lasts for 2 weeks. Full rehabilitation takes 3-6 months. Both of the heart aneurysm treatment options require patients to return to their normal activities gradually.

Outlook

With timely diagnostics and effective treatment over 90% of the patients return to their normal lives with minimal lifestyle alteration. General recommendations to prevent progression of the disease include quitting smoking and drinking, scheduling exercise routines, and maintaining healthy diet.
